Everglades National Park Slay Day
May 2, 2026
We headed out early for a morning half day fishing charter in Everglades National Park, and conditions were excellent — Sunny with about 15mph winds. The Mangrove Snapper bite was absolutely dialed in, with consistent action throughout the day. Spotted Seatrout have also been around we were able to catch several nice ones for dinner. We sent some quality Mangrove Snapper and Spotted Sea trout home for a fresh Florida Keys dinner, while the rest were carefully released to fight another day. The trips showstopper was the long fight on a 40lb Goliath grouper with light tackle back in the mangroves it can prove to be a tough battle. Overall, it was a fantastic half day Everglades National Park fishing charter — great weather, steady action, and plenty of smiles back at the dock. If you're looking to experience backcountry fishing in the Florida Keys, conditions are shaping up nicely summer is around the corner which is my favorite time of year to fish.

Inshore Bite & Mixed Species Action
March 2, 2026
This weekend’s trips produced excellent action across the Florida Keys, with steady bites and a great variety of species coming over the rails. On our Florida Keys fishing charters, anglers enjoyed productive conditions and nonstop opportunities throughout the day. We put together a solid dinner catch of mangrove snapper, landing a bunch of nice-sized mangrove snappers that were perfect for the table. The snapper bite stayed consistent, making for a fun and rewarding inshore fishing trip. The highlight of the weekend was an absolute beast — a giant jack crevalle that took nearly 20 minutes to land, putting both angler and tackle to the test. These powerful fish are known for their strength, and this one did not disappoint. Adding to the excitement, we also landed a flounder, which is a rare catch in the Florida Keys and always a cool surprise on a guided fishing charter. Along with that, we caught several miscellaneous species, keeping rods bent and action steady throughout the trip. Overall, it was another successful weekend of Florida Keys fishing, with great variety, memorable fights, and plenty of fresh fish headed home. Conditions are shaping up nicely, and we’re looking forward to more productive Florida Keys fishing trips in the coming days.

Winter fishing
January 9, 2026
Fishing has been pretty strong on the shallow reefs with a wide variety of snapper and grouper lately. Some wahoo and sailfish have been showing up with the cooler weather. Fishing should continue to get better during the tempature drops. Plenty of opportunities to have a fun day on the water

Action packed days on the water
December 29, 2025
The bite has been hot lately with plenty of action and great variety. We’ve been getting into big schools of jack crevalle, providing nonstop excitement, hard runs, and plenty of drag-screaming fights to keep rods bent all trip long. For those looking to take something home for dinner, the mangrove snapper bite has been steady with quality fish that have been perfect for the table. Even better, there have been some larger snook showing up in the mix. We’ve seen some impressive fish cruising around and feeding, giving us some incredible opportunities at trophy-class catches. With good water, steady bait, and strong tides, conditions have been lining up great and the fish have been responding. Overall, it’s been a great time to get out on the water—plenty of action, great variety, and chances at some truly memorable fish.

Late Summer Fishing is Underrated
August 8, 2025
The redfish have been schooling up recently making the best time of year to target redfish while sight fishing. I have been seeing schools of up to 20+ fish cruising in inches of water making for a show. I have also seen and caught more 30+ inch redfish these past few months than I have going back years. The snook fishing bite early in the morning has been hot fishing small troughs stacked with fish. You might have to weed through some 24" fish to find the real big ones, but they still pull plenty hard. I've also been seeing some big tarpon cruising the shallows with their back out of the water feeding on mullet. This is one of my favorite times of year to fish because the weather is usually nice and all the species are active making it a great time of year to target a backcountry slam.

Inshore bite is hot!
March 1, 2025
Cooler morning temperatures are turning the bite on. The past few weeks fishing has been great with 3 backcountry slams caught in a day the redfish, snook, and trout are eating. Snook season just opened up so this weekends purpose was to bring home fresh snook and that we did along with a lot of other bycatch. The redfish seemed to be everywhere with a quadruple hookup to end the day with only 3 people onboard made for a great end of the trip.
